file-type

JSP网站后台开发实战:增删改查与分页功能

RAR文件

下载需积分: 9 | 441KB | 更新于2025-07-18 | 41 浏览量 | 109 下载量 举报 收藏
download 立即下载
在这个关于源码网站后台项目(简单版)的知识点介绍中,我们将涉及JSP技术、数据库操作(特别是SQL存储过程)、以及分页技术。接下来我们将详细介绍这些知识点。 ### JSP技术 JSP(JavaServer Pages)是一种用于开发动态网页的技术,它是Java EE(Java Platform, Enterprise Edition)规范的一部分。JSP允许开发者将Java代码嵌入到HTML页面中,这样开发者可以使用Java语言的全部功能来创建动态生成的内容。JSP页面通常包含HTML标记,并使用特定的JSP标签来插入Java代码段。 - **JSP生命周期**:JSP页面从被请求到响应给客户端会经历一系列的生命周期,包括:转换请求、编译、加载类、实例化、初始化、处理请求、销毁实例。 - **JSP内置对象**:JSP定义了一组内置对象,如request、response、session、application、out、config、pageContext等,它们可以直接在JSP页面中使用,而无需进行初始化。 - **JSP指令和动作**:指令用于设置与整个页面相关的属性,比如页面指令(page)、包含指令(include)和标签库指令(taglib)。动作则用来创建和修改对象,以及用来插入跨页面组件,如useBean、setProperty、getProperty等。 ### 数据库操作 数据库操作是Web应用中的核心,涉及到对数据的增加、删除、修改和查询(CRUD)。数据库操作常用SQL(Structured Query Language)语言来实现。 - **SQL存储过程**:存储过程是一组为了完成特定功能的SQL语句集,它可以被存储在数据库中,供以后调用。存储过程可以接受参数、执行业务逻辑,并可返回结果。 - **对数据库的操作案例**:具体来说,对于“增删改查”(CRUD)操作的案例,这些操作对于学习如何管理数据库中的数据至关重要。 ### 分页技术 在处理大量数据时,分页显示数据是一种常见的技术,它能够提高网站性能并改善用户体验。 - **分页案例**:分页技术涉及从数据库检索数据,并将数据分割成小的“页”来显示。实现分页通常需要知道当前页码、每页显示的记录数以及总记录数,然后通过SQL查询对数据进行分页筛选。 ### 合一项目 “合一项目”可能是指将上述技术合并在一个统一的应用程序中,通过实际项目来应用这些知识点,从而加深理解和掌握。 ### 数据库备份 数据库备份是任何项目中至关重要的一个环节,它涉及到数据的安全性和恢复能力。 - **数据库备份的重要性**:备份可以防止数据丢失,减少因硬件故障、软件故障、误操作或恶意攻击导致的数据损失。 ### 项目实践和交流 该项目还强调了实践操作的重要性,并提供了联系方式以便于学习者之间的交流。 - **实践操作**:通过实际操作来学习JSP和数据库知识,可以更好地理解理论知识,并且能够实际解决遇到的问题。 - **交流渠道**:提供EMAIL和QQ联系方式,有助于项目参与者之间互相交流问题和解决方案。 ### 总结 源码网站后台项目(简单版)是一个很好的实践项目,它结合了JSP技术和数据库操作,包括存储过程和分页技术。这些技术是构建动态网站所必需的。通过这个项目,学习者可以加深对JSP页面结构、数据库CRUD操作以及分页查询实现的理解。同时,项目还强调了代码备份的重要性以及学习者之间交流的价值。对有志于深入学习Web开发和数据库管理的人来说,这样的项目是一个极好的起点。

相关推荐

zhuseahui
  • 粉丝: 65
上传资源 快速赚钱